The 13103 / 13104 Bhagirathi Express is an express train running between Sealdah and Lalgola, thereby linking Kolkata with the Murshidabad district, in the state of West Bengal. This train covers 228 km (142 mi) of distance at an average speed of 52 km/h (32 mph), and through its journey, it passes through important stations like Ranaghat, Krishnanagar, Bethuadahari, Plassey, Beldanga, Berhampore, Murshidabad, Jiaganj, Bhagawangola, Lalgola.
